Hiring Substitutes Sample Clauses

Hiring Substitutes. Whenever an employee or an aide is absent the District shall make an honest effort to replace that employee, during the term of his/her absence, with a suitable substitute. The salary of certificated substitutes shall be as per negotiated agreement and as stated in Appendix A.

Hiring Substitutes. If possible, substitutes will be hired to cover classes of regularly assigned teachers when they are absent.
Hiring Substitutes. Whenever an employee or an aide is absent the District shall make an honest and complete effort to replace that employee, during the term of his/her absence, with a suitable substitute. Asking another employee to give up plan time to substitute for the absent employee shall qualify as loss of plan time under Section C Number 4 of this Article.
Hiring Substitutes. Every effort will be made to use Subfinder to secure substitutes when certificated employees are absent. In the event that a substitute is not available, the building principal shall make other arrangements on a temporary basis to cover said absence. A certificated employee who will be absent from work will follow district procedures included in the buildings’ Staff Handbooks. Absences must be reported by 6:00 a.m.

  • Long-Term Substitutes Long-term substitutes are defined as teachers hired to fill the temporary vacancy of a teacher on leave in the same assignment for more than sixty (60) days. The employment of long-term substitutes shall automatically expire at the end of the period of substitution or upon return to duty of the teacher from an approved leave of absence without any action by the Board or further notice to the teacher.

  • Substitutes 10.5 The responsibility for the selection, orientation and employment of substitutes rests at the local school level. The principal, or his/her designee, shall be responsible for obtaining qualified substitutes. Teachers shall not be required to obtain their own substitutes.
